Specific Responsibilities

Begin to deal directly with General Contractor or Vendor as a company representative regarding the estimate

Understand the National Electric Code in order to review drawings for accuracy and completeness

General understanding of requirements/standards used for:

  • Typical buildings constructed in the Denver market

Perform or review electrical layout of incomplete drawings ensuring the drawings are up to National Electric Code

Read and understand architect provided narratives using independent judgment and discretion to apply the narrative to complete drawings

Determine equipment cost in lieu of quotes based on independent judgment and experience with guidance from Preconstruction Manager

Write complete proposal and narrative describing conceptual layout developing a budget for the project based on incomplete information prior to project review with Preconstruction Manager

Perform pre-bid reviews with junior Estimators (preliminary review before Preconstruction Manager’s final review)

Develop skills in tracking all cost impacts and changes along with generating cost alternatives (value engineering)

Attend preconstruction job meetings with Preconstruction Manager representing the company to clients

Track all cost impacts of job prior to turnover to construction

Attend turnover meetings with Preconstruction Manager to explain estimate and budget to construction personnel for constructability

Perform full take off by scraping plans, counting fixtures and electrical equipment and entering information into the estimating system

Send quotes out to vendors

Enter and price quoted from vendors into estimating system

Scope quotes, checking subcontractor quotes and bids for completeness and recommends

  • Revisions where necessary
  • Participates in vendor selection along with PCM
  • Ensures the vendors priced a complete package and didn’t leave any holes in their quotes
  • Come up with qualifications based off the drawings they scraped
  • Qualify exceptions Encore has taken to the drawings
  • Explains deviations from drawings to General Contractor
  • Answers general questions from the contractor about their estimate
